Ashgabat to celebrate TURKSOY opera days and Veli Mukhadov’s anniversary

On April 18, President Serdar Berdimuhamedov chaired a regular digital meeting of the Cabinet of Ministers. During the meeting, Vice-Premier Bahar Seyidova reported on the ongoing cultural and humanitarian cooperation with the International Organization of Turkic Culture (TURKSOY). This was reported by the "Turkmenistan: Golden Age" online newspaper.

Preparations are currently underway to hold an opera concert in the capital this May, dedicated to the 110th anniversary of the birth of the prominent Turkmen composer Veli Mukhadov. Additionally, it is planned to organize the TURKSOY Opera Days at a high level as part of this event.

Turkmenistan actively cooperates with TURKSOY in preserving the shared tangible and cultural values of Turkic peoples and promoting the heritage of great thinkers worldwide. The Vice-Premier submitted relevant proposals for holding these international cultural events to the Head of State for consideration.

After hearing the report, President Serdar Berdimuhamedov emphasized that the country attaches great importance to the development of international cultural relations. The Head of State instructed to ensure thorough preparation for the planned opera concert and cultural events, ensuring they are conducted at a high organizational level.
